Why Patient Identification is Still a Major Risk Area
Despite advancements in medical technology, patient misidentification continues to cause:
- Medication errors
- Diagnostic delays
- Wrong procedures
- Billing disputes
- Legal claims of negligence
In high-volume environments like hospitals, pathology labs, and outpatient clinics, even a small lapse-such as two patients with similar names-can trigger serious clinical and legal consequences.
This is especially risky in settings where:
- Multiple professionals access the same records
- Paper-based systems are still in use
- Teleconsultations are increasing
- Documentation is fragmented
These risks directly impact not just patient outcomes, but also a doctor’s legal exposure and professional reputation.

Wearables and Smart Identification: The Next Step
Wearable devices and smart identification tools are now being adopted in advanced healthcare systems to further reduce human error. These include:
- Wristbands with scannable IDs
- Smart badges for inpatients
- Mobile-based verification for OPD patients
When integrated with a patient identification platform, wearables can:
- Automatically match patients to lab samples
- Prevent wrong-bed or wrong-procedure errors
- Track care journeys in real time
This is particularly useful in busy labs and hospitals, where multiple tests and procedures happen simultaneously.

Regulatory and Professional Alignment
Digital identification and compliance tools also align with the direction of Indian healthcare regulation.
The Indian Medical Association (IMA) consistently advocates for better documentation, ethical practice, and patient transparency to protect both doctors and patients. Similarly, the Clinical Establishments Act promotes standardisation of healthcare processes, record-keeping, and accountability across private and public healthcare facilities.
As regulations evolve, clinics and hospitals will increasingly be expected to demonstrate:
- Proper patient records
- Informed consent trails
- Secure data handling
- Standardised care protocols
Digital patient identification is the starting point for meeting these expectations.
